**Action item 7: Compress telemetry payloads from Fernwick agents**

Heads up, support folks — during the outage, uncompressed telemetry from Fernwick edge agents chewed through our ingest quota and made everything slower to diagnose. We're rolling out gzip on all agent payloads over the next two sprints. Customers on agent versions older than 4.2 will see a banner nudging them to upgrade; no action needed on your end beyond pointing them at it. Rollout status and the customer-facing talking points are tracked here.

runbook for badug-kadup: https://confluence.zemvarlabs.internal/projects/browse/display/projects/bd1b

NOTES — EXAM PAPER DELIVERY, PRENWOOD CAMPUS

Quick recap for the receiving site: sealed exam papers arrive Tuesday morning via Saxhall Couriers. Boxes stay sealed until the invigilation team signs for them — no peeking, no early sorting. Keep them in the locked store, not the front office. The hand-over instruction for the courier sits on the next line.

courier memo of yahif-faweg: the quenael tamius courier leaves the prawyn jorix kaswyn istox silmir brieth zormir fenvan ledger at gate 3145 under passcode 231062

## Artifact Signing — Checkout Load Tests

Load-test bundles for the Farrowgate checkout flow must be signed before upload to the Drayton artifact store. Unsigned bundles are rejected by the runner. Build with the standard profile, cap virtual users at 20k, and archive results per run. Future maintainers: rotate quarterly, never reuse retired material. Sign each bundle using the key below.

rollout seal: bky4_x7Gc

Subject: DR Drill — Vendored Fonts Restore

Team,

During next week's disaster-recovery drill, we'll restore the vendored third-party fonts for the Quillmark renderer from cold storage. Please verify each font family renders correctly in test tickets and note any substitutions. Restoring the font archive requires unlocking the offline bundle, so keep the following passphrase at hand.

unlock words, hahip-baduf: holwyn-istath-julvan

Subject: DR drill — kiosk watchdog

Review before Thursday. Drill scope: Lanternfall kiosk app watchdog. We kill the renderer, confirm watchdog restarts it under 10s, then simulate full host loss. Check the restart backoff logic in my branch — I capped it at three attempts. Recovery console needs manual unlock during the drill; use the passphrase that follows to get in.

unlock words, fafop-hawep: briwyn-oliix-sorox